Secured by two bolts for easy disassembling, the offered clamp is used to fix 2 way copper tape for uninterrupted and safe transmission of power. Allowing conductors to be overlapped, this clamp is manufactured with the use of high grade brass and contemporary techniques. Superior Conductivity and DurabilityCrafted from high-quality brass compliant with IS 319 Grade I standards, the test clamp assures optimal conductivity and mechanical strength. Its substantial tensile strength of 400 MPa, alongside excellent corrosion resistance, guarantees long-term performance in demanding environments. The nickel plated and natural brass finishes further enhance durability, making it suitable for rigorous earth testing needs.
Versatile Application and Easy InstallationDesigned to be portable and user-friendly, the screw down clamp can accommodate up to 12mm conductors, making it ideal for quick earth testing and test connection setups. The screw terminal allows secure wire fixing, while its compact rectangular structure ensures hassle-free mounting. This versatility makes it the preferred choice for field engineers and technicians.
FAQs of Screw Down Brass Test Clamp:
Q: How is the Screw Down Brass Test Clamp used in earth testing and test connections?
A: The clamp is utilized to establish secure and reliable connections for earth testing by fixing the test conductor onto its screw terminal. Its design ensures firm gripping of conductors up to 12mm, making it suitable for various test setups and environments.
Q: What are the benefits of choosing a brass test clamp over other materials?
A: Brass offers superior electrical conductivity, high corrosion resistance, and excellent mechanical strength, which contribute to the clamps durability and consistent performance. These properties ensure longevity, especially in harsh or corrosive conditions.
Q: Where is this test clamp typically installed or used?
A: The clamp is used on portable earth testing setups, electrical panels, and field-service environments where temporary or reliable test connections are necessary. Its convenient shape and easy mounting support versatile deployment across multiple sites.
Q: What is the process for fixing the wire to the clamp?
A: To secure a conductor, simply insert the wire (up to 12mm diameter) into the screw terminal and tighten the screw for a stable connection. This process ensures minimal contact resistance and enhances the accuracy of testing procedures.
Q: When should I use the natural brass versus nickel-plated finish?
A: Nickel-plated versions provide enhanced corrosion resistance and are recommended for environments with high moisture or chemical exposure. Natural brass is suitable for standard installations where corrosion risk is moderate.
Q: What compliance standards does this clamp meet?
A: The product adheres to IS/IEC standards and is RoHS compliant, ensuring it meets both electrical safety regulations and environmental protection requirements.
